Effects of Comprehensive Lifestyle Modification on Diet, Weight, Physical Fitness, and Blood Pressure Control: 18-Month Results of a Randomized Trial

At 18 months, participants in both behavioral intervention groups had less hypertension, more weight loss, and better reduction in sodium and fat intake than those receiving advice only, and the DASH diet group also increased their intake of fruits, vegetables, and fiber.Abstract:
The authors randomly assigned 810 adults with prehypertension or early-stage hypertension to receive advice on changing diet and exercise, a behavioral intervention, or the behavioral intervention ...read more
